diff options
author | ivan <ivan> | 2006-06-18 12:54:49 +0000 |
---|---|---|
committer | ivan <ivan> | 2006-06-18 12:54:49 +0000 |
commit | c738a3c4923774b64960aa87fa58bd0751487edb (patch) | |
tree | e037c5c2e1211dd16c8024f16c9ce4d1fe589efb /httemplate/edit/process/elements | |
parent | aaad08cae3a0d46d012de5b78360101cda836c30 (diff) |
ACLs: finish group edit (agents + rights) & browse
Diffstat (limited to 'httemplate/edit/process/elements')
-rw-r--r-- | httemplate/edit/process/elements/process.html | 15 |
1 files changed, 14 insertions, 1 deletions
diff --git a/httemplate/edit/process/elements/process.html b/httemplate/edit/process/elements/process.html index 59ad35ee4..a6e3b50e3 100644 --- a/httemplate/edit/process/elements/process.html +++ b/httemplate/edit/process/elements/process.html @@ -16,7 +16,14 @@ # 'viewall_dir' => '', #'search' or 'browse', defaults to 'search' # 'process_m2m' => { 'link_table' => 'link_table_name', # 'target_table' => 'target_table_name', - # }. + # }, + # 'process_m2name' => { 'link_table' => 'link_table_name', + # 'link_static' => { 'column' => 'value' }, + # 'num_col' => 'column', #if column name is different in + # #link_table than source_table + # 'name_col' => 'name_column', + # 'names_list' => [ 'list', 'names' ], + # }, my(%opt) = @_; @@ -52,6 +59,12 @@ ); } + if ( !$error && $opt{'process_m2name'} ) { + $error = $new->process_m2name( %{ $opt{'process_m2name'} }, + 'params' => scalar($cgi->Vars), + ); + } + if ( $error ) { $cgi->param('error', $error); print $cgi->redirect(popurl(2). "$table.html?". $cgi->query_string ); |